Fenerbahce vs Ferencvaros prediction

Fenerbahce sacked Jose Mourinho in August and he was replaced by former Belgium boss Domenico Tedesco. The Turks have remained steady in their form as they head into this one on the back of a 5-2 victory over Caykur Rizespor in the Super Lig to mean that they are now unbeaten in their last ten matches across all competitions.

Coached by Celtic-linked Robbie Keane, Ferencvaros have underwhelmed domestically this season and that continued at the weekend with a 3-1 defeat at home to Nyiregyhaza Spartacus. In the UEFA Europa League, the Hungarians have collected ten points from their opening four matches in the league phase.

The Hungarians will head to Turkey with a bit of attacking intent and so this could be quite an entertaining encounter in which both teams scoring this week.
